Take a gander at how we load a frozen grid with vitrified sample into the Gatan Elsa CryoHolder for our Talos L120C system. One of the toughest training aspects for CryoEM is teaching the fine motor skills to manipulate your sample safely.

What’s cooler than being cool? Ice. ❄️🧊
In cryo-EM, vitrified ice preserves hydration and near-native structures so we can image biology at atomic scale. We avoid crystals… but when one appears, it’s a reminder of the clever science we use to get these images.
